Rade Pribićević, the Corporate and Regulatory Affairs Director at Danube Foods Group, passed away yesterday (July 27, 2010) at the age of 44.

He had worked at Knjaz Milos before he assumed that position, while his career began in company BAT in Belgrade. He later worked for that company in Bulgaria, Germany, Switzerland, and again in Serbia. He was also a member of the Managing Board of Special Hospital in Arandjelovac, the Chairman of Secopak's Managing Board and Bambi Banat's Managing Board, as well as a member of Serbian Association of Managers.

He passed the bar exam shortly after he graduated from the Law School in Belgrade. He tried to earn for his living working as a lawyer in the 1990's, but he earned more in that period by doing translations to German language, which he mastered while living in Vienna.

As a child, he was often changing the cities of residence because his father worked as a diplomat. He was born in Belgrade. He first moved to Zagreb and then to Vienna where he completed secondary school.
